Communication Counselling to Help You Say What You Mean

Communication is something we do every day, but it’s not always easy. When expressing yourself feels difficult, interactions can become stressful, confusing, or even conflict-filled. When emotions run high, communication can break down quickly, particularly for people who experience anger or emotional reactivity. You might struggle to articulate what you truly want to say, freeze up in group settings, or sit on the edge of conversations without contributing — even when you want to. For many people, communication difficulties are closely connected to anxiety — especially in high-pressure or emotionally charged situations. Tough conversations about emotions, money, feedback, or boundaries can feel impossible, leaving you unsure how to speak up or listen effectively. Misunderstandings can build, and self-doubt may hold you back from using your voice confidently. Communication counselling can help you understand what gets in the way of expressing yourself and build the skills to navigate conversations with more confidence and clarity.

In counselling, we start by understanding the mental, emotional, and historical factors that influence your communication patterns. Together, we’ll explore the fears, self-talk, and beliefs that get in your way and set clear goals for what you want to achieve. You’ll learn practical strategies for navigating challenging conversations, participating in group discussions, and addressing confrontation with confidence. We’ll also focus on listening skills — noticing when to take someone at face value and when to pause and decode the underlying message.

Through practice, reflection, and guidance, you’ll gain confidence in your ability to communicate effectively. Over time, counselling helps you approach conversations with clarity and ease, strengthen your relationships, and trust yourself to navigate interactions with skill and self-assurance.
